Output 2874666b5bdee66527a4b4e14175c1e37c9c2b842ffd76bd0a4c015b09d7296b:20

value
537909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b5cd95925d5f399f8c4221a45b6a8bec2b7bd35 OP_EQUALVERIFY OP_CHECKSIG
address
1CFHLrm1KGy6LMZRVdTRrsVUi1LRECfGwy
transaction
2874666b5bdee66527a4b4e14175c1e37c9c2b842ffd76bd0a4c015b09d7296b
spent
true